The 1715 Çakaristan elections were the third Grand Vizier elections since the restoration of the Çakar Empire. In these elections, the number of electoral votes and available seats in the Majlis al-Shuyukh had increased. This was due to the incorporation of Jaguda, Kadim, Kyazilkai and Nuristan.

Dervish Çelebi ran for his second term on behalf of United Green. This time he had Aytac Kizilkaya as his opponent, on behalf of the Party for Unity of Craitists.


Grand Vizier election

Article 4.1 of the Akbar Constitution describes the election of Grand Vizier. The person must be a free citizen, at least thirty-five years of age and reside in the Empire for at least ten Norton years. Each governorate, riyasat and subah has as many electors as the total number of Shuyukh to which the governorate, riyasat or subah is entitled in the Çakari Congress. Each sarkar has one elector. The electors cast their ballots with the name of the candidate who received the most votes in their governorate, riyasat or subah.

Results

Dervish Çelebi retained the superstates, except for Kendall Khanate. Aytac Kizilkaya won in almost all the added territories except Barikalus and his home state.

All this resulted in victory for Dervish Çelebi:

Majlis al-Shuyukh

One third of the Majlis al-Shuyukh is elected every two Norton years. The term of a Shuyukh is six Norton years. This is the sixth election for the Majlis al-Shuyukh, but with an increase in the number of seats. A brief overview of the distribution of seats by party:
